| pla·ya [ plyə ] (plural pla·yas) |
noun |
|
| Definition: |
| |
bed of inland desert drainage basin: the lower part of an inland desert drainage basin that is periodically filled with alkaline and briny salts washed down by rainwater from surrounding highlands
|
| [Mid-19th century. Via Spanish, "beach" < late Latin plagia "plain, shore"] |
